The cloud provides on-demand servers that can be created in seconds with the click of a button or a call to Steadfast’s engineering team. Cloud users can create one server for a particular project or dozens or more servers to support heavy traffic on a popular site or application.
But the cloud is not the only type of server hosting available to you. Why choose the cloud for your business instead of shared hosting, dedicated servers, or traditional virtual private servers?
The cloud levels the infrastructure playing field. The ability to quickly deploy servers used to be something that only big companies with expensive IT departments could manage. Today, every business has access to reliable enterprise-grade servers in seconds.
Cloud users can create as many servers as they need, and they only pay for the resources they use. When a business no longer needs a cloud server, it can be removed as quickly as it was created. There are no long-term contracts or penalties: the cost of a business’s servers accurately tracks its infrastructure needs.
Cloud servers are available in a wide range of configurations, from low-powered servers that make great testing and development to high-performance machines that are excellent for hosting busy websites, application backends, or databases.
Because additional servers can be created on-demand, there is no need to over-provision servers to account for peak loads and traffic spikes. Underutilized servers have to be paid for even when they’re idle. On the cloud, businesses simply deploy the servers they need at any particular time and pay only for what they use.
On the cloud, there is no wait-time between need for a server and server availability. When a developer wants to launch a server to test out an idea, they don’t have to fill out a form and wait until the IT department signs off on it. They simply spin up a server and run their code. Cloud servers help your business create products more quickly, test them more efficiently, and get them to market sooner.
SMBs who use the cloud don’t have to worry about managing, securing, and maintaining physical servers. They don’t have to invest time and money to make sure their servers are reliable and always available. We take care of that so that cloud users can focus on what really matters.
Deploying an infrastructure platform with a single point of failure is a critical mistake, one made by many new cloud users. Redundancy helps ensure greater uptime and availability while reducing the risk of data loss.
